Kenneth B. Koestel  |1921-2022| 

Posted Jun 28, 2022 1:14 PM

Kenneth B. Koestel, 101, passed away Saturday, June 25, 2022, at Hospice House, Hutchinson.

Kenneth was born on January 3, 1921, in Arlington, the son of John Peter and Beulah May (Breeze) Koestel Jr.  On December 27, 1976, he married Mavis M. Cannon, after a 1 month courtship.  They shared 38 years of marriage prior to her death on December 17, 2014.

Kenneth graduated from Arlington High School, Arlington, Kansas.  He was a U.S. Army veteran serving from 1944 to 1946, when he was honorably discharged after serving in World War II.  Kenneth was the co-owner and manager for Pella Products, Inc. and retired in 1984. 

He was preceded in death by his parents; wife, Mavis Koestel; a brother, Vincent Koestel; and three sisters, Esther Smalley, Corinne Gibson and Velma Hipp.Kenneth is survived by his five children, Gary (Susan) Koestel, Cindy Koestel, Kim (Chris) Humiston, all of Hutchinson, Janet (Daniel) Mora of Liberty Township, Ohio, and Pam (Craig) Hietmann of Richardson, Texas; three step- children, Steve (Diane) Cannon of Hutchinson, Greg (Debbie) Cannon of Maize and Chris (Kathy) Cannon of Hutchinson; 20 grandchildren; 38 great grandchildren and two great- great grandchildren.

Cremation is planned. A private graveside inurnment service will be held at a later date.
